CAUTION:
Write-protection will not protect your cartridges against magnets. Write-protection will not prevent a
cartridge being erased by bulk-erasure or degaussing. Do not bulk erase Ultrium format cartridges. This
will destroy pre-recorded servo information and make the cartridge unusable.

Cleaning the tape drive

You must use the Ultrium Universal cleaning cartridge with HP StorageWorks Ultrium tape drives, as
other cleaning cartridges will not load and run.
To clean the tape drive:
HP StorageWorks Ultrium tape drives do not require regular cleaning. An Ultrium universal cleaning
cartridge should only be used when the orange Clean LED is flashing.
1.
Insert the Ultrium universal cleaning cartridge.
2.
The drive will carry out its cleaning cycle and eject the cartridge on completion (which can take up
to 5 minutes). During the cleaning cycle the orange Clean LED will be on solidly and the green
Ready LED will flash.
Each HP Ultrium universal cleaning cartridge cleaning cartridge (C7978A) can be used up to 50
times with Ultrium tape drives. If the cleaning cartridge is ejected immediately with the Tape LED on,
it has expired.
